Publicado originalmente en 1950, este maravilloso libro es una nueva muestra del buen gusto de Elizabeth David, pero también de su carácter intrépido, ya que presentan una exquisita y variada selección de platos que descubrió y aprendió a elaborar durante el tiempo que pasó viviendo en Francia, Italia, las islas griegas y Egipto. Deliciosas recetas de pasta italiana, ensaladas aromáticas provenientes de Turquía y Grecia o marisco español se dan cita en un volumen que celebra la calidad, la simplicidad y la variedad de la dieta mediterránea.

A Book of Mediterranean Food
is Elizabeth David’s  first book and made her a favorite with foodies everywhere.
Originally published in 1950
is based on a collection of recipes she made while living in France, Italy, the Greek islands, and Egypt. She gives us hearty pasta and polenta dishes from Italy; aromatic and tangy salads from Turkey and Greece; and tasty seafood and saffron dishes from Spain. Whether it is the simplicity of hummus, or the delicious blending of flavors found in plates of ratatouille or paella, Elizabeth David's wonderful recipes in
are imbued with all the delights of the sunny south.

Elizabeth David (1913-1992) is the woman who changed the face of British cooking. Having travelled widely during the Second World War, she introduced post-war Britain to the sun-drenched delights of the Mediterranean and her recipes brought new flavors and aromas into kitchens across Britain.
